#e7dc9e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e7dc9e is composed of 90.6% red, 86.3% green and 62%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 4.8% magenta, 31.6% yellow and 9.4% black. It has a hue angle of 51 degrees, a saturation of 60.3% and a lightness of 76.3%. #e7dc9e color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#cfb93d. Closest websafe color is: #ffcc99.

#e7dc9e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#e7dc9e has RGB values of R:231, G:220, B:158 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.05, Y:0.32, K:0.09. Its decimal value is 15195294.

Hex triplet e7dc9e #e7dc9e
RGB Decimal 231, 220, 158 rgb(231,220,158)
RGB Percent 90.6, 86.3, 62 rgb(90.6%,86.3%,62%)
CMYK 0, 5, 32, 9
HSL 51°, 60.3, 76.3 hsl(51,60.3%,76.3%)
HSV (or HSB) 51°, 31.6, 90.6
Web Safe ffcc99 #ffcc99
CIE-LAB 87.312, -5.431, 31.878
XYZ 64.719, 70.645, 42.572
xyY 0.364, 0.397, 70.645
CIE-LCH 87.312, 32.337, 99.669
CIE-LUV 87.312, 10.115, 44.778
Hunter-Lab 84.051, -9.643, 28.804
Binary 11100111, 11011100, 10011110

Shades and Tints of #e7dc9e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0c03 is the darkest color, while #fefefc is the lightest one.

Tones of #e7dc9e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#c6c5bf is the less saturated color, while #feec87 is the most saturated one.
